Adjective: scungy (scungier,scungiest)
Usage: Austral, NZ, informal
  1. Thickly covered with ingrained dirt or soot
    "a miner's scungy face";
    - begrimed, dingy, grimy, grubby [informal], grungy [informal], raunchy [US, informal], manky [Brit, informal]

Derived forms: scungier, scungiest

See also: dirty, soiled, unclean
